Inter boosted by Ronaldo training game

First Published: Apr 26, 2002

Internazionale are ready to declare Brazilian striker Ronaldo fit to face Piacenza on Sunday as their title challenge nears conclusion.

Ronaldo was suffering a thigh strain earlier in the week but played in Thursday's 11-a-side practice match at the club's training ground.

He was used for one half only but should be fit to play at least some part against Piacenza.

Inter lead the title race by one point from Juventus with AS Roma a further two points back.

Italian international striker Christian Vieri is also suffering with a thigh problem and did not train yesterday. Inter coach Hector Cuper has Uruguayan Alvaro Recoba and Nicola Ventola to use as his strikers if Ronaldo is restricted to a substitute appearance.
